Vegan Protein Quiche

For a quick start to your day that doesn’t sacrifice flavor or belly-filling vegan protein, try these vegan mini quiches. 

Mix chickpea flour with water in a 1:1 ratio until you’ve created an egg-like consistency. Then add a sprinkle of nutritional yeast, a pinch of salt, and your favorite seasonings for flavor (you can’t go wrong with some garlic powder and oregano). 

Next, whisk in some of your favorite vegetables. Really anything goes — think of these as yummy ways to clean out your fridge. Looking for some inspo? Try adding a combo of sun-dried tomatoes, broccoli, and sauteed onions. For some extra protein and a sausage-y flair, add some diced tempeh sauteed in smoked paprika, cumin, and sage (you can also buy it preseasoned).

Neatly spoon your “quiche” mixture into the muffin cups, then bake at 420ºF for 20 minutes. These last 3–5 days covered in the refrigerator and make an easy (and delicious) on-the-go breakfast. 

Seitan: A Meatless Protein Powerhouse

Seitan is a protein found in wheat that’s commonly known as gluten. Seitan packs 25 grams of protein a serving, making it one of the best plant protein sources available. It has a neutral flavor which allows it to take on the flavors of its surrounding ingredients. If your body can handle gluten, it’s one of the best available sources of vegan protein. 

Try adding seitan to your vegan mini-quiche or any other meal for added vegan protein. It’s even great sauteed by itself as a side with some toast and scrambled tofu. 

Savory Hummus

Hummus is a great source of vegan protein: it’s packed not only with protein, but also with healthy fats and several vitamins, minerals, and antioxidants. Made from chickpeas, tahini, garlic, lemon juice, and olive oil, hummus can add some vegan protein into your favorite everyday vegan snacks.

And it’s not just for snacks — use hummus instead of mayonnaise on your favorite sandwich or simply slather it on some toast for a quick bite of vegan protein that’s both satisfying and easy to assemble.

Spread hummus on toasted baguette slices and top with sun-dried tomatoes, figs, and apples for a bruschetta guaranteed to please at your next gathering. 

Vegan Protein Cookie Dough

You likely already know that chickpeas are a highly versatile food capable of making everything from hummus to chili, but did you know you can use them to make vegan cookie dough?

Take one 15 oz. can of drained chickpeas and mix in a blender with ½ cup of almond flour, a spoonful of your favorite nut butter, a handful of dates, a teaspoon of baking powder, and chocolate chips.  Mix until it looks good enough to lick off the spoon — and then do just that!

Mindful Munchies

Nuts and seeds are a great source of vegan protein and are packed with healthy fats and flavor. From cashews to sunflower seeds, shelled or unshelled, raw or roasted, there are so many different ways you can enjoy these mini protein powerhouses.

Better yet, make a snack mix by combining all your favorite nuts and seeds together. Try adding some roasted chickpeas or edamame tossed in paprika and cumin for some additional vegan protein and a spicy flair.
